Introduction:

Operational excellence represents a structured approach to aligning processes, accountability systems, and risk management within organizational environments. It connects clarity of roles, performance frameworks, and readiness structures to ensure consistency, efficiency, and resilience. This training program presents operational excellence frameworks, accountability models, and risk readiness structures aligned with modern organizational systems. It provides an institutional perspective on how organizations structure operations, define responsibilities, and enhance readiness through coordinated performance systems.
